Transfer an existing tenant to Openrent?

I have a property with a tenant and their partner in it. I have always been a ‘hands on” landlord but am reaching the point where I want to step back a bit. So I thought of transferring the tenant (and partner) over to Openrent. Can this be done and what is involved? The deposit we have was taken about 15 years ago and since then the rent has risen so the deposit is a few hundred pounds lower than the current rent. What would Happen?

To do this you’d have to post an advert, get your tenant to pay a holding deposit, a create a new tenancy with a new deposit.

I don’t understand how you would benefit. Openrent do not ‘manage’, so the only job they would do for you would be to collect the rent for you.

You need a lettings agent/property manager, as Karl2 says openrent don’t manage.
